Bernnadette Stanis,[4] also billed as Bern Nadette Stanis (born Bernadette Stanislaus,[5] December 22, 1953),[6][2] is an American actress and author. Powers joined the cast of Good Times during the show's sixth and final season, when the character of Keith was introduced as a former football player and Thelma's love interest.
